Finished Craft [Mine] Skull Cane

Thumbnail
gallery
2 Upvotes

The skull is made from re-melted 3D printing supports amd waste. The cane itself is purple heart and maple. In 2023 I tore my ACL and MCL and Meniscus and had to use a cane for a couple months amd I didn't like the medical versions. I accidentally shattered the skull and tried to epoxy it with gold epoxy. I will likely one day try to sand or buff it out to get a better effect. I'm currently working on a D20 version for an upcoming craft show.

Question / Advice When is glue-free assembly actually an advantage in miniature kits?

1 Upvotes

Glue-free sounds easier until the goal of the project gets considered. Someone who mainly wants clean assembly and clear stopping points may prefer snap-fit or slot-style construction because there is less waiting for pieces to set. Someone who enjoys shaping, positioning, and adjusting tiny handmade details may find that same structure less interesting.

The useful comparison is probably not “modern versus traditional,” but how much hands-on fabrication the builder actually wants. What does glue add to the experience that a good mechanical connection cannot?
